AXIO的问题1、技术概述1、 :指的是浏览器不能执行其他网站的脚本。它是由浏览器的同源策略造成的,是浏览器对javascript施加的安全限制。 2、问题的出现 开发一些前后端分离的项目,使用 SpringBoot + Vue 开发时,后台代码在一台服务器上启动,前台代码在另外一台电脑上启动,此时就会出现问题。 比如: 后台 地址为 http://192.168.70.77:8081
转载 2023-07-07 14:23:33
229阅读
# 接口的实现(Axios Blob 的使用) 在现代的Web开发中,请求是一个常见问题,特别是在使用Axios进行HTTP请求时。本文将详细介绍如何实现接口,并处理Blob数据。以下是整件事情的基本流程: ## 流程概述 | 步骤序号 | 步骤描述 | 代码示例 | | -------- | ---------------
原创 2024-09-29 04:20:46
104阅读
# 解决axios blob问题 在前端开发中,我们经常会使用axios来发送网络请求。当我们需要下载文件时,通常会将文件返回为blob格式。然而,当文件存储在不同域名下时,就会遇到问题。本文将介绍如何解决axios blob问题,并提供代码示例。 ## 问题描述 当使用axios发送请求下载文件时,服务器返回的数据是一个blob对象。如果文件存储在不同域名下,浏览器会阻止
原创 2024-06-07 05:01:22
615阅读
是由浏览器同源策略引起的,是指页面请求的接口地址,必须与页面url地址处于同上(即域名,端口,协议相同)。这是为了防止某名下的接口被其他域名下的网页非法调用,是浏览器对JavaScript施加的安全限制。这个措施出发点是好的,但在项目开发的过程中,常常给前端开发者带来麻烦。 由于页面开发中,静态资源是放在本地电脑上的,访问这些资源通常通过IP方式(127.0.0.1)或者localhost
转载 2023-09-16 00:25:02
255阅读
# 使用 Vue 和 Axios 加载 Blob 资源的完整指南 在现代 web 开发中,处理文件下载和加载是一个常见的需求。尤其是在 Vue 应用中,使用 Axios 来处理 HTTP 请求是非常普遍的。然而,加载 Blob 数据时会有一些额外的考量。本指南旨在教会你如何在 Vue 中使用 Axios 加载 Blob 数据,并将流程和代码详细说明。 ## 流程概述 为方便理解,
原创 2024-10-02 06:27:05
227阅读
axios 写法axios.get("xxx地址").then( (response) => { console.log(); }, (error) => { console.log(error); } );问题解决
转载 2023-05-18 12:00:18
301阅读
问题是由于浏览器的同源策略限制导致的,同源策略是浏览器的一种安全策略,目的是保障用户的信息安全,防止恶意网站窃取数据。同源策略的限制是,当在浏览器中发起一个请求时,浏览器会拦截请求,不允许发送和接收任何数据。
转载 2023-05-18 19:10:08
1262阅读
为什么使用 axios: 发送ajax请求,解决问题  什么是: 发送ajax请求的时候要求同源,什么是同源,就是协议名、主机名、端口名一致。  怎么解决 开启一个代理服务器,代理服务器与我么所处的位置相同,就是协议名,主机名,端口号一致。我们像代理服务器发送ajax请求,代理服务器收到请求后会向目标服务器发送http请求,http请求是没有问题的,当代理服务器
背景:因为axios中只能使用get和post方法来进行请求数据,没有提供jsonp等方法进行访问数据          axios中文网址:https://www.kancloud.cn/yunye/axios/234845方案1:既然使用axios直接进行访问不可行,我们就需要配置代理了。代理可以解决的原因:因为客户端请求服务端的数据是
转载 2023-07-04 13:05:07
181阅读
一、Axios1、Axios介绍Axios 是一个开源的可以用在浏览器端和 NodeJS 的异步通信框架,她的主要作用就是实现 AJAX 异步通信,其功能特点如下:从浏览器中创建 XMLHttpRequests从 node.js 创建 http 请求支持 Promise API拦截请求和响应转换请求数据和响应数据取消请求自动转换 JSON 数据客户端支持防御 XSRF (站请求伪造)GitHub
转载 2023-09-13 10:13:08
184阅读
0.什么是        浏览器的同源策略会阻止从一个加载的脚本去获取另一个上的文档属性。凡是发送请求url的协议(https协议访问http协议)、域名(包括子域名)、端口(80端口访问8080端口)三者之间任意一个与当前页面地址不同即为。1.使用CROS解决问题   &n
转载 2023-08-26 12:46:09
316阅读
axios实现cros网站 www.npmjs.com,能搜索到插件安装及使用方式axios最终返回的是promise对象axios 是一个基于Promise 用于浏览器和 nodejs 的 HTTP 客户端,它自己具备如下特征:从浏览器中建立 XMLHttpRequest从 node.js 发出 http 请求支持 Promise API拦截请求和响应转换请求和响应数据取消请求自动转换JSO
vue 解决axios请求出现前端问题最近在写纯前端的vue项目的时候,碰到了axios请求本机的资源的时候,出现了访问报404的问题。这就让我很难受。查询了资料原来是的问题。在正常开发中问题有很多的解决方案。最常见的就是后端修改响应头。但是前端也可以解决,通过反向代理。为了防止下一次这样的错误出现,记录一下,总结一下。所以现在我们来复盘一下,然后解决掉。一、为什么会出现的问题?
转载 2023-07-04 14:23:09
295阅读
产生的原因当协议、子域名、主域名、端口号中任意一个不相同时,浏览器会将请求视为请求,限制浏览器在不同之间的资源请求。对的误解浏览器在发现请求时,会根据同源策略(Same-Origin Policy)进行限制,不允许直接在浏览器中获取请求的响应数据。这意味着即使服务器正常响应了请求,浏览器也无法将响应数据返回给页面,导致无法在前端使用该数据。解决方法在Vue项目中的 /sr
转载 2023-08-10 22:13:52
400阅读
main.jsimport Axios from 'axios'Vue.prototype.$axios = Axios; Axios.defaults.baseURL = '/api'; Axios.defaults.headers.post['Content-Type'] = 'application/json'; vue2中vue.config.js无效,vue3中config/index.
转载 2021-05-06 23:04:05
354阅读
2评论
axios问题解决方法 1.打开vue.config.js进行配置 devServer: { proxy: { '/api': { target: 'http://www.xxx.com.cn/', // 要请求的API changeOrigin: true, // 是否开启 pathRew ...
转载 2021-10-15 17:17:00
236阅读
2评论
# axios 在前端开发中,我们经常需要从不同的域名下获取数据。但是由于浏览器的同源策略,只允许在同一个域名下进行数据交互,访问数据会受到限制。为了解决这个问题,我们可以通过使用axios库来实现请求。 ## 什么是 在浏览器中,同源策略是一种安全机制,它限制了一个文档或脚本如何与另一个源互动。同源是指协议、域名、端口号完全相同,即使两个域名只相差一个端口号,也被当作
原创 2023-08-02 07:32:41
47阅读
 axios解决问题(vue-cli3.0)阅读目录一、什么是1、2、同源策略3、问题怎么出现的二、使用 axios 演示并解决问题(vue-cli3.0)1、项目创建、与 axios 的使用2、问题重现3、解决问题  回到顶部一、什么是1、  指的是浏览器不能执行其他网站的脚本。它是由浏览器的同源策略造成的,是浏览器对javascript施
转载 2024-02-16 09:38:22
1508阅读
报错信息:Access to XMLHttpRequest at 'http://127.0.0.1:3652/' from origin 'http://localhost:8080' has been blocked by CORS policy: No 'Access-Control-Allow-Origin' header is present on the requested resou
转载 2023-07-04 14:47:57
192阅读
Ajax简介Ajax全称为 Asynchronous JavaScript And XML 就是异步的JS和XML XML:可扩展标记语言 被设计用来传输和存储数据优点:可以无刷新页面与服务器进行通信允许你根据用户时间来更新部分页面内容缺点:没有浏览历史,不能回退存在问题SEO不友好(搜索引擎优化)Ajax返回的状态0 - (未初始化) 还没有调用send()方法1 - (载入)已调用send
  • 1
  • 2
  • 3
  • 4
  • 5